Obesity

If there’s any medical condition associated with low testosterone that should top the list of dangerous diseases and disorders, it should be obesity. That’s simply because obesity can lead to various other health diseases that can really increase your risks of death.

For one, obesity and diabetes almost go hand in hand. High blood pressure, gout, osteoarthritis, cancer, heart disease, and stroke are all closely associated with obesity. The biggest problem with obesity when it comes to your testosterone levels is that obesity further exacerbates the problem.

Obese men tend to have lower T levels than men who are of normal weight. That’s partly due to the actions of aromatase, an enzyme which fat cells also secrete. Conversion of T into female sex hormones such as estradiol happens through the actions of aromatase.

Diabetes

diabetes and insulinDiabetes can lead to the destruction of your internal organs if you don’t manage your blood sugar levels well. Just like obesity, diabetes is also closely linked with low testosterone levels. Men with low T have a higher risk of developing diabetes as compared to men whose testosterone levels are within the normal range.

The kicker is that uncontrolled diabetes can also destroy your erection. Chronic high blood sugar levels damage your blood vessels and nerves. And the tiny blood vessels and nerves inside your penis are very susceptible to the damage caused by diabetes.

Not only does diabetes cause erectile dysfunction but it can also increase your risks of death. Diabetes will damage your kidneys, which is why many diabetic patients often require dialysis. As your kidneys fail, your risks of death further increase.

Osteoporosis

By itself, osteoporosis is not deadly nor contagious. But it does increase your risks of falling and sustaining fractures. Death due to accidental falls and fractures is actually very common among elderly people.

When you leave your low testosterone levels untreated, it can eventually lead to osteoporosis. Loss of bone mass is actually a common symptom of low T. As your testosterone levels continue to stay below the normal range, you will also continue to lose bone mass until your bones become brittle and fragile.

Depression

Your testosterone levels are also important to your mood regulation. As your testosterone levels decline, you’ll experience many physical changes in your body. You’ll often feel fatigued and your sexual desire and performance will decline. All of these factors can also contribute to depression.
